What are the chords for free falling?

As you can see above, the chords for Free Fallin’ without the capo are D, G, and Asus4. You can use these chords to play both Tom Petty’s and John Mayer’s versions.

What is an asus4 chord?

A. Sus4 (or just sus) stands for „suspended 4th“. The 3rd of a major or a minor chord is suspended and replaced by a perfect 4th. On the guitar you can easily get this chord by taking the chord shape of a major chord and moving the major 3rd (can occur more than once in a chord shape) up by just one fret (a half-step).

What tuning does Tom Petty use?

The tuning is standard tuning, E A D G B E.
